One common route is to graduate from an accredited medical assistant program with at least 720 hours of training, including 180 hours in a hands-on clinical externship.

Ophthalmic MA's assist ophthalmologists in providing eye care such as measuring and recording vision, conducting diagnostic tests such as testing eye muscle function, applying eye dressings, and teaching patients how to insert and care for contact lenses.
